Matheus B. Araujo Walter R. Tschinkel

Workers of the polymorphic fire ant Solenopsis invicta Buren (Hymenoptera: Formicidae) show modest changes of shape with increases in body size. These shape changes (allometries) have been described only for workers taken from mature colonies of the monogyne social form. Hildemberg Agostinho Rocha de Santiago Lucas Rodolfo De Pierro Rafael Menezes Reis Antônio Gabriel Ricardo Engracia Caluz Victor Barbosa Ribeiro José Batista Volpon

PURPOSE To investigate allometric relationships among body mass (BM), muzzle-tail length (MTL), and tibia length (TL) in Wistar rats and establish their growth rate change parameters. METHODS Eighteen male and 18 female Wistar rats were studied from the 3rd to the 21st week of age. BM, MTL, and TL were measured daily, and relative growth was compared using allometry. Maren Ranheim Gagnat Per-Arvid Wold Tora Bardal Gunvor Øie Elin Kjørsvik

Small fish larvae grow allometrically, but little is known about how this growth pattern may be affected by different growth rates and early diet quality.
